Background and Entry Level Mindset Questions
Addresses a candidate's educational and early professional background together with an entry level learning orientation. Topics include relevant coursework, internships, projects, self-study, and clear articulation of current skill level and gaps. For entry level candidates, interviewers expect humility, eagerness for mentorship, and examples of quickly acquired skills. This canonical topic evaluates baseline experience plus readiness and attitude to grow from an early career stage.

Design a 30-day learning plan to move from 'basic regression and classification' to building a production-ready binary classification pipeline that includes data cleaning, feature engineering, modeling, basic monitoring, and a deployment demo. Outline weekly milestones, resources, and measurable outcomes.

Walk me through a project where you engineered features from unstructured text or images. Describe the preprocessing steps, features extracted, why you chose them over simpler baselines, and how you evaluated that those features improved performance.

Role-play: A product manager asks for a model that predicts user churn 'tomorrow' within one week, but you have limited labeled data and no pipeline. Explain how you'd set expectations, propose a minimal viable deliverable (MVP) with timeline and resource needs, and what success criteria you'd use.

Explain your familiarity with version control. Provide a short example of a git workflow you have used (branching, pull requests, code review) and describe one common mistake beginners make and how you avoid it.

Walk me through your educational background (degrees, majors, relevant coursework, capstone projects). For each item, explain one concrete skill or technique you learned and how it maps to typical data scientist responsibilities such as data cleaning, exploratory analysis, modeling, or visualization. Mention specific tools (Python, R, SQL, scikit-learn, TensorFlow, Tableau) and one area where you want to improve.
